C18 exhibits The everyday attributes of the alkyl group - non-polar and ionically inert in commonest situations. Retention from a C18 stationary phase emanates from weak van der Waals intermolecular power that draws hydrophobic compounds. C18 together with other alkyl phases like C8 and C4 represent one of the most fundamental style of reverse stage HPLC.

If the cellular phase passes through the column, Each individual component during the sample begins to separate and elute at different time. 

Greater molecules are swiftly washed in the column; smaller molecules penetrate the porous packing particles and elute later on.
